Start Your France copyright Process: A Step-by-Step Guide For

Planning a trip to the enchanting country of France? Before you toss your bags, you'll need to obtain a French visa. The application process may seem daunting, but with careful preparation and these detailed instructions, you can manage it with ease.

First, figure out the type of visa that fits your trip. Are you traveling to France for tourism, business? Each visa category has specific requirements.

  • Next, gather all the necessary documents, including your copyright, updated photographs, evidence of financial means, and a completed application form.
  • Present your application along with the required documents to the French embassy or consulate in your home country.
  • Be prepared to attend an interview as part of the application process. This is where you'll answer questions about your trip and demonstrate your eligibility for a visa.

Upon the review of your application and interview, you'll receive a decision on your visa. If approved, you'll be granted a visa that allows you to enter France.

Obtaining a French Tourist copyright

Applying for a French tourist copyright is a simple process. You can submit your application through the official website of the French mission. Before submitting your application, make sure you have all the essential documents, such as a valid copyright, proof of travel arrangements, and a statement of purpose for your trip. You will also need to pay a visa fee online. Once your application is processed, you will receive an email with further instructions.

The processing time for a French tourist visa can vary depending on the applicant's nationality and the volume of applications. It is advised that you apply for your visa at least a few weeks in advance of your planned trip to France. To make certain a smooth application process, it is important to meticulously review the application requirements and instructions on the French embassy website.
